The Talent Matrix Quadrant Report lets you track how employees have moved through talent matrix quadrants over time. The report only includes the employees that you have access to based on your reporting hierarchy and location.
The report includes:
- Entries for each active talent matrix in the organization.
- Entries for every employee included in the talent matrices, including those not yet rated.
- For each employee: which talent matrix quadrant they are in, and the succession plans they're assigned to.
- For employees who were assigned to several quadrants over the specified date range, there's a separate row for each quadrant.

Custom Fields
Quadrant Name
If a quadrant in the talent matrix hasn’t been assigned a name, the Quadrant Name field shows instead the name of the x-axis and the rating assigned to the employee, then the name of the y-axis and the rating assigned. For example, "Performance - High, Potential - Medium."
Filters
The template provides filters for limiting the results to a date range during which quadrants were changed, and to limit the results to talent matrix, manager, or employee names.
